The Oakton Cougars will look to defend their home court on Wednesday against the Westfield Bulldogs at 7:15 p.m. Westfield took a loss in their last match and will be looking to turn the tables on Oakton, who comes in off a win.
Oakton took a loss when they played away from home last Tuesday, but their home fans gave them all the motivation they needed on Monday. They blew past Centreville 3-0. The victory was a breath of fresh air for the Cougars as it put an end to their three-game losing streak.
Meanwhile, Westfield came up short against Chantilly on Monday, falling 3-0. The defeat continues a trend for the Bulldogs in their matchups with the Chargers: they've now lost five in a row.
Westfield was was forced to take the loss, but they sure made Chantilly work for it, especially in the second set. The match finished with set scores of 25-14, 26-24, 25-16.
Oakton's win bumped their record up to 2-8-1. As for Westfield, their loss ended a five-game streak of away wins and brought them to 14-4.
